Meeting for the Palestinian leadership led by Arafat
Palestine, Politics, 6/7/2003
A Palestinian official source said that the Palestinian President Yasser Arafat held a meeting on Friday with senior officials in the Fatah movement and the Palestinian Liberation Organization PLO in order to discuss results of the tripartite summit which was held on Wednesday in al-Aqaba, Jordan.
An official at Arafat's office said that members in the PLO executive committee and other officials held a meeting with Arafat at his general residence in Ramullah ( the West Bank).
Arafat was due to have held then talks with members of the central committee of the Fatah movement on the results of the meeting which was held on Wednesday between the Palestinian prime minister Mahmoud Abbas and the Israeli Ariel Sharon in the presence of the UN President George W. Bush.
Arafat was ruled out of this summit which officially launched the international peace plan known as "the Roadmap" which states the foundation of a Palestinian state by the fall of 2005.
